Abstract

An optimal steady-state sequential distributed filter has been derived and tested. A limited-memory type modification is presented and shown to have superior convergence properties compared to the optimal filter when a number of replicate data sets are available for processing. Experimental data from a styrene-monomer tubular-reactor pilot plant were processed using the modified filter since replicate sets of data were available. Results show steady-state sequential filtering to be effective and robust.
